Filing 4
ORDER FILED. Mary M. SCHROEDER, Johnnie B. RAWLINSON, Jacqueline H. NGUYEN We have reviewed the application for authorization to file a second or successive 28 U.S.C. 2255 motion. Because the applicants claim of prosecutorial misconduct was not ripe when his first 2255 motion was denied by the district court, the applicant is not required to seek authorization from this court before proceeding in the district court with this claim. See Panetti v. Quarterman, 551 U.S. 930, 947 (2007). The clerk will transfer the application at Docket Entry No. 1, to the United States District Court for the Central District of California, Case No. 2:20-cr-00409-JAK-1, to consider its merits in relation to the first 2255 motion. The motion is deemed filed in the district court on September 4, 2025, the date the application was delivered to prison authorities for forwarding to this court. See Fed. R. App. P. 4(c)(1); Houston v. Lack, 487 U.S. 266, 270 (1988); Orona v. United States, 826 F.3d 1196, 1198-99 (9th Cir. 2016) (AEDPAs statute of limitations period is tolled during pendency of an application). The clerk will send a copy of this order and the application to Judge John A. Kronstadt. Upon transfer of the application, the clerk will close this original action. Because the application is being transferred to the district court, we take no action on any pending motions. No further filings will be entertained in this case. DENIED AS UNNECESSARY. APPLICATION transferred to the district court. [Entered: 11/13/2025 03:55 PM]
